Very interesting soulslike where you consume the essences of certain dead people, then use them to fight. You basically can switch between 4 different characters at any moment, and dealing damage with one character will drain health to heal up the ones in reserve. Pretty cool, but seems to be very early so it's still pretty janky and runs like shit. Will keep my eye out for it tho.
